ingredients
- vegetable oil (or your choice of oil, coconut oil sounds wonderful to me)
- 2 eggs, beaten
- 2 large garlic cloves (pressed or minced)
- 2 tablespoons gingerroot, minced
- 6 cups rice (unsalted, cooked)
- 1 (8 ounce) can water chestnuts, sliced (drained)
- 1 cup ham, julienned
- 1 cup carrot, shredded
- 1 cup frozen peas, thawed
- 1 cup green onion, chopped
- 1⁄3 cup soy sauce
directions
- Heat 2 tablespoons oil in a 12-inch skillet. Add eggs. Tilt skillet so eggs form about a 6-inch pancake. Cook until set spooning oil over eggs where necessary to set edges. Remove from skillet with a spatula. Cool; cut into strips.
- Add 3 tablespoons oil to skillet. Saute garlic and ginger. Add rice; stir fry, lifting from from the bottom until grains separate. Add water chestnuts, ham, carrots, peas, green onion and soy sauce. Continue to lift from bottom while stir-frying. Remove from heat. Stir in egg strips.

Made for the FYC tag game to serve w/a stir-fried pork dish tagged in another game. I halved this recipe & left out the peas (not a fave w/us) plus the water chestnuts just because I did not have any. I really tried to follow the recipe otherwise, but made 1 error as I worked in haste to get dinner on the table for DH who was hovering over me like he had not had a meal in days. I added the egg strips while I was still lifting & frying the rice, which caused them to break up into the rice mixture. It certainly did not seem to hurt this colorful fried rice w/a mix of textures & great flavor. This recipe would work well as a main-dish w/shrimp replacing the ham IMO.
